Program Analysis
Graduates of Rutgers University-Newark's Finance and Financial Management Services program earn a higher salary than the national average. One year after graduation, the average salary is $68,338, which is more than the national average of $59,479. Five years after graduation, the average salary increases to $86,111.
The program has a favorable debt-to-earnings ratio. The average debt for graduates is $0.
The program graduates a significant number of students each year. Approximately 294 students graduate from the program annually.
